A Doctor's Advice: Don't Avoid the Hospital if You Need Emergency Care

Published: April 20, 2020, 4:16 p.m.

As COVID-19 patients crowd into hospitals, doctors are reporting very few patients are coming in for the usual crises - heart attacks, strokes and other emergencies. Dr. Harlan Krumholzprofessor of medicine at Yale and director of the Yale New Haven Hospital Center for Outcomes Research and Evaluation says hospitals are ready to treat people for non-COVID emergencies, and urges patients to still seek medical care when they need it.
